Cost of Attendance (COA)

The following table compares the 2024 costs of attendance between selected colleges. For state residents, the average COA is $28,988 when living on campus and $31,114 when living off campus. For out-of-state students, the average COA is $44,278 when living on campus and $46,404 when living off campus. The COA includes tuition, fees, books & supplies, room & board costs, and other living expenses.

Undergraduate Tuition & Fees

The following table compares 2023-2024 undergraduate tuition & fees between selected colleges. The average undergraduate tuition & fees is $10,310 for in-state students and $25,600 for out-of-state students. The 2023-2024 undergraduate tuition & fees of selected colleges are increased by 4.82% compared to the previous year.
Among the selected colleges, University of Colorado Boulder requires the most expensive tuition & fees of $41,943 and Pueblo Community College has the lowest tuition & fees of $17,116 for undergraduate programs.
